    Bicycle riding is allowed everywhere but the paddock. Must walk bikes in the paddock, have to stay on the roads artound the track. Scooters must have a current registration and plate. No ATV's or golf carts for spectators. Competitors can use atv's, golf carts with a permit and ride bicycles in the paddock.

    Rules are right on their website.
